If you're like me and love adding a personal touch to your digital or print projects, experimenting with a variety of fonts can truly transform your work. I recently explored some fun and adorable fonts like Adelia, Starborn, and Bubblegum—each bringing a distinct vibe. For instance, Adelia's smooth, rounded letters add softness and warmth, ideal for anything related to kids or whimsical themes. Starborn offers a more modern and sleek look, great for futuristic or cosmic projects. Another favorite is the Hello Kitty-inspired font, which instantly brings a playful and nostalgic feel, perfect for invitations or casual branding. Using these fonts, I've noticed my designs feel more lively and approachable. Don't hesitate to combine these fonts within a single project; for example, pairing a bold font like Starborn with the softer Bubblegum can create striking contrast and focus. When searching for fonts, consider what emotions or themes you want to convey. Cute fonts tend to evoke friendliness and creativity but can also be versatile for professional uses when paired thoughtfully. Tools like Adobe Fonts or Google Fonts offer a wide range of options and sometimes even free versions of similar styled fonts if you want to experiment further.
